Crítica aims to publish a number of special issues on contemporary philosophical topics of international relevance. Every special issue will have one or more Editors, who will be approved by the Board of the journal, and will feature roughly 4 articles: some will be obtained through an international call for papers, and the remaining ones by invitation. The call for papers will be announced in both English and Spanish in PHILOS-L, PhilEvents, et alia. The Editor will take care of finding referees for all the articles, including the ones obtained by invitation. The review process is double-blind, and only manuscripts that obtain two positive reports will be publishable. The Editor will have the option to choose between writing either a preface or a substantive introduction; if the latter, the manuscript will also go through blind review. Under no circumstances the issue will contain work by the Editor, other than the preface or the introduction. Once the selection process has been finalized, the Board of Crítica will reserve the right to approve all contributions. The Board will be available to the Editor for help throughout the process.

We invite proposals for special issues. Please send a document with the following information: (i) description of the topic, (ii) draft of the call for papers, (iii) names of authors which will be invited to contribute. The Board of Crítica will assess the proposals.
